UEW TESCON initiates sensitization programme on new cedi

Tanoso (Ash), April 18, GNA - The University of Education Winneba (Kumasi Campus) branch of the Tertiary Students Confederation (TESCON) of the New Patriotic Party (NPP) has drawn up a comprehensive programme to sensitise the people of three districts on the upcoming re-denomination of the new cedi currency.

The districts are Atwima-Nwabiagya, Atwima-Mponua in Ashanti and Nadowli in the Upper East region.

Mr Martin Rich Mills Yeboah, President of the TESCON told the Ghana News Agency at Tanoso near Kumasi that the group would also educate the people on the National Identification Programme. He said the programmes would begin on April 21 and last for two weeks.
